Assay Principle

The Eagle Biosciences anti-Pseudomonas aeruginosa IgG anti-Pseudomonas aeruginosa IgG EIA, E15, is a sandwich enzyme immunoassay. Serum or plasma samples are diluted and added to the wells of a microtiter plate, which have been previously coated with the Pseudomonas aeruginosa antigens alkaline protease, elastase or exotoxin A. Specific antibodies in the sample bind to the antigens present during an incubation of 2h at 37°C. After washing, the conjugate (anti-human IgG peroxidase-labelled immunoglobulin) is added and incubated again (for 2 h at 37°C). After a final washing step, substrate is added and further incubated for 30 min at room temperature. The reaction is terminated on addition of stop solution accompanied by a change from blue to yellow. The absorbance of the coloured reaction product is measured on a microtiter plate reader. The colour intensity of the reaction corresponds to the concentration of antibodies in the sample.


SPECIMEN COLLECTION, PREPARATION AND STORAGE
Serum samples are suitable. A special external sample preparation prior to assay is not required. Slight hemolysis of the samples doesn’t disturb the determination. Samples should be handled as recommended in general: as fast as possible and chilled as soon as possible. In case there will be a longer period between the sample withdrawal and determination, store the undiluted samples frozen -20°C or below in tightly closable plastic tubes. Avoid on principal repeated freeze-thaw cycles of serum/plasma (if required, please subaliquote).

Assay Background


Pseudomonas aeruginosa, a Gram-negative bacterium ubiquitously distributed in the moist environment, causes about 10% of all nosocomial infections. This opportunistic pathogen leads to acute and chronic types of infection within the various organs.  P. aeruginosa infection provokes a rapid production of antibodies to a large number of P. aeruginosa antigens. Eagle Biosciences’s sensitive antibody detection system detects a P.aeruginosa infection very early at the onset.  Due to the use of three P.aeruginosa antigens, which are highly immunogenic and present in different parts from nearly all P.aeruginosa strains.  Depending on the Pseudomonas aeruginosa species and the immune reaction, antibodies can be detected against a single, two or even all three antigens simultaneously. A sample is regarded as sero-positive when antibodies against one or more of the antigens can be detected.
